Halifax Community College details


Halifax Community College address is 100 College Drive, Weldon, North Carolina 27890. You can contact this school by calling (252) 536-7242 or visit the college website at www.halifaxcc.edu .
This is a 2-year, Public, Associate's--Public Rural-serving Small according to Carnegie Classification. Religion Affiliation is Not applicable and student-to-faculty ratio is 11 to 1. The enrolled student percent that are registered with the office of disability services is 3% or less .
Awards offered by Halifax Community College are as follow: Less than one year certificate One but less than two years certificate Associate's degree.
With a student population of 1,559 (all undergraduate) and set in a Rural: Fringe, Halifax Community College services are: Remedial services Academic/career counseling service Employment services for students Placement services for completers On-campus day care for students' children . Campus housing: No.
Tuition for Halifax Community College is $2,250. Type of credit accepted by this institution Dual credit Advanced placement (AP) credits . Most part of the informations about this college comes from sources like National Center for Education Statistics
